Holy Names vs. Woodbury

Both Holy Names University and Woodbury University are Private, 4 years schools located in California. The following statements compare Holy Names University and Woodbury University with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
  • Both schools are private.
  • Woodbury's tuition ($47,056) is more expensive than Holy Names ($42,115).

  • Holy Names's students to faculty ratio (9 to 1) is lower than Woodbury (13 to 1).
  • Holy Names (959 students) is larger than Woodbury (849 students) with more enrolled students.
  • Holy Names ($30,810) has higher amount of financial aid than Woodbury ($22,616).
  • Woodbury's graduation rate (60%) is higher than Holy Names (53%).
